Mayor Lee's Statement on Hellman Family Legacy & Continued Commitment to San Francisco

Mayor Edwin M. Lee today issued the following statement:

“I want to acknowledge the Hellman family for their continued commitment to San Francisco residents.  The extraordinary generosity of time and philanthropic donations from the Hellman family and the late Warren Hellman have touched the lives of so many, leaving a lasting legacy on our City. 

Always at the center of great causes, Warren Hellman and the Hellman family have been dedicated to improving the lives of San Francisco residents for decades.  For many, the most notable contribution from the Hellman family is the creation and sponsorship of Hardly Strictly Bluegrass in our world-class Golden Gate Park.  Each year, the annual music event brings together friends, families and visitors to celebrate San Francisco’s vibrant communities and the arts. And as the event has grown over the last 15 years it has become an opportunity for visitors from all across the nation and around the globe to take advantage of everything San Francisco has to offer. That means folks spending money in our small businesses, eating at our restaurants, and spreading the word about our great City, all of which plays an important part in our growing economy.

I’m grateful to the Hellman family for their continued efforts to carry out Warren Hellman’s legacy of philanthropy and dedication to art, music, education, science and more. It’s this kind of dedication and compassion for our City that will continue to make it a great place to live and visit for generations to come.”
